We are looking for a highly motivated Sales Content Program Manager to join our Sales Content Team within the Global Client Solutions organization, specifically supporting Agency, SMB and Reseller content development. This role is an exciting opportunity to support the execution of high-impact projects and initiatives that enable the sales organization. This person should have a strong sense of content formats and use cases, experience in building sales processes and proactively manage tasks. This person will work closely with the designers and copywriters on the Sales Content team, as well as cross functional partners, to bring sellable solutions to life through collateral.
What you’ll do:
Lead project meetings, manage milestones and deliverables across Sales Content projects, ensure deadlines are met, and proactively flag roadblocks / barriers that might hinder projects from launching on time.
Understand different content types and their use cases. Be able to identify and persuade cross functional partners to move forward with the most impactful content format based on objective.
Lead impactful story arcs in our content development. Be able to visualize the story we need to tell, and work closely with designers and copywriters to bring it to life.
Partner with Agency Enablement and SMB Enablement cross-functional team members to address these specific persona content needs and nuances.
Contribute to continuous innovation and improvement to optimize knowledge, behavior, and skills for high-performing sales teams.
Analyze and lead project reviews to improve and evolve from learnings, always be optimizing.
Experience with AI-supported content strategy is a plus.
What we’re looking for:
- 5-7 years of relevant content strategy and/or project management experience working at fast-paced / fast-growing organizations – tech or ad sales experience is a plus.
- A self-starter with a can-do attitude who is able to work in a complex, ambiguous environment.
- Incredible attention to detail and impeccable organizational and communication skills.
- Ability to multi-task in a challenging and fast-paced environment with a sense of urgency.
- Familiarity with tools and systems such as Google Workspace, project management tools (e.g. Asana, Coda, Smartsheets) and content management systems (e.g. Highspot, Seismic, Salesforce)
-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field such as advertising or equivalent experience

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ene
Key Facts About Charlotte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
-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
-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
-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
-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
